Dokuz Eylül University (DEU) orthosis : an orthotic method of preventing ankle equinus during tibial lengthening

ANGIN S; UNVER B; KARASTOSUN V
PROSTHET ORTHOT INT , 2003, vol. 27, n° 3, p. 238-241

An orthosis developed in Dokuz Eylul University (DEU) at the School of Physical Therapy and Rehabilitation, Department of Orthotics and Prostheticsis is described. It is applied as a non-invasive device attached to the distal ring of the Ilizarov external fixator to keep the ankle joint in a neutral position and prevent ankle equinus during tibial lengthening with Ilizarov technique. This minimises additional invasive techniques such as heel cord release and prophylactic pinning of the heel and the foot, and manipulation under anaesthesia. It may also be detached by the physiotherapist or patient when physical therapy is needed during the lengthening procedure.
